This Inventory Analyst will be doing analysis for an inventory forecasting model (SAP IBP). They need to have technical expertise to extract data as well as functional knowledge to see if the data is trending in the correct direction. (ex) we noticed a trend for a price reduction). There is a testing component, when they are in UAT, they should be able to prepare the test scenario that makes sense to the business (change the price and see what you get from the tool) and display the data to tell a story with the data showing process and price.

You start by checking real-time stock status in our ERP (SAP/Oracle), confirm raw material receipts, and walk the floor to validate counts for work-in-process (WIP) and finished goods (FG). Mid-morning, you lead targeted cycle counts, reconcile any mismatches you uncover, and kick off root-cause analysis to minimize inventory variance. After lunch, you partner with Production to align inventory levels to the build schedule, supporting Just-in-Time (JIT) manufacturing and lean practices. You wrap the day by updating reports-variance analysis, inventory turnover metrics-and flagging corrective actions that keep materials flowing without excess or obsolete stock.
